RING STAND

  • Iron rings connect to a ringstand and provide a stable, elevated platform for the reaction.
  • Above the station

BUSEN BURNER

  • Bunsen burners are used for the heating of nonvolatile liquids and solids.
  • Above the station

TEST TUBES AND RACK

  • Test tube racks are for holding and organizing test tubes on the laboratory counter.
  • Above the station

SAFETY GLASSES

  • It protects your eyes from the chemicals
  • Above the station

BEAKERS

  • Beakers hold solids or liquids that will not release gases.
